Horng-yu Wu is a scholar working on Mechanical Engineering, Biomaterials and Mechanics of Materials. According to data from OpenAlex, Horng-yu Wu has authored 26 papers receiving a total of 487 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Mechanical Engineering, 17 papers in Biomaterials and 12 papers in Mechanics of Materials. Recurrent topics in Horng-yu Wu’s work include Aluminum Alloys Composites Properties (19 papers), Magnesium Alloys for Biomedical Applications (17 papers) and Metallurgy and Material Forming (12 papers). Horng-yu Wu is often cited by papers focused on Aluminum Alloys Composites Properties (19 papers), Magnesium Alloys for Biomedical Applications (17 papers) and Metallurgy and Material Forming (12 papers). Horng-yu Wu collaborates with scholars based in Taiwan and United States. Horng-yu Wu's co-authors include Woei-Ren Wang, Hsinhan Tsai, Shang-Chih Wang, Shyong Lee and Jian-Yih Wang and has published in prestigious journals such as Materials Science and Engineering A, Journal of Materials Science and Journal of Alloys and Compounds.
